(get_elemental_fcn_charlen): New function to map the character length of an elemental function onto its actual arglist. (gfc_conv_expr_descriptor): Call the above so that the size of the temporary can be evaluated. * trans-expr.c : Include arith.h and change prototype of gfc_apply_interface_mapping_to_expr to return void. Change all references to gfc_apply_interface_mapping_to_expr accordingly. (gfc_free_interface_mapping): Free the 'expr' field. (gfc_add_interface_mapping): Add an argument for the actual argument expression. This is copied to the 'expr' field of the mapping. Only stabilize the backend_decl if the se is present. Copy the character length expression and only add it's backend declaration if se is present. Return without working on the backend declaration for the new symbol if se is not present. (gfc_map_intrinsic_function) : To simplify intrinsics 'len', 'size', 'ubound' and 'lbound' and then to map the result. (gfc_map_fcn_formal_to_actual): Performs the formal to actual mapping for the case of a function found in a specification expression in the interface being mapped. (gfc_apply_interface_mapping_to_ref): Remove seen_result and all its references. Remove the inline simplification of LEN and call gfc_map_intrinsic_function instead. Change the order of mapping of the actual arguments and simplifying intrinsic functions. Finally, if a function maps to an actual argument, call gfc_map_fcn_formal_to_actual. (gfc_conv_function_call): Add 'e' to the call to gfc_add_interface_mapping. * dump-parse-tree.c (gfc_show_symbol_n): New function for diagnostic purposes. * gfortran.h : Add prototype for gfc_show_symbol_n. * trans.h : Add 'expr' field to gfc_add_interface_mapping.
